Introduction summary Amazon, Inc. is considered to be the leading online retailer in the world today with a platform of sale for over 40 different goods categories ranging from machine/motor auto parts, books, groceries and electronics. Apart from this, the large organization also has a platform for internet technology and ecommerce, a platform for internet advertising, a platform for logistics and fulfilment, an internet incubator for startups, and a search technology. The company was started in Seattle, America back in the year 1994 in July by Jeff Bezos, who was a former New York investment banker. Before Amazon achieved its great success, it was the original idea of Jeff to start a bookstore to sell books online. The company has tremendously advanced from an online bookstore to a globally known online Wal-Mart where many products are sold such as Hardware and Tools, games and toys, Cookware and Music CDs. Amazon gross sales over the years have shown the company’s incredible growth with revenue s back in 1997 being $150 million growing over $100 billion today (Kargar, 2004; Mellahi Johnson, 2000). External Environment 1) Technology This remains to be the company’s greatest asset as it employs the use of technology to advance its e-commerce business.
